Spas
Love being pampered with manis, pedis, facials, and luxury spa or beachside massages? Cabo has dozens of elegant, first-class spas, including the Spa at Esperanza which was rated as the best in all of Latin America. Romantic couples treatments are an area specialty.
Sport Fishing
Cabo is home to the world’s richest fishing tournament, Bisbee’s Black and Blue, and big-game sportfishing is one of the area’s most popular pursuits. Hundreds of hearty fisherman search the Sea of Cortez for Marlin, Tuna, and other deep-sea delights.
Golf
Los Cabos has been a premier golfing destination since the early 1990s, and some local courses have been ranked among the 100 best in the world, hosting PGA and other world-class events.
Art
Art and fiesta lovers should take in the San Jose del Cabo Art Walk, held each Thursday evening of the high season. Many great galleries showcase work from the country’s best contemporary artists as well as traditional Mexican folk art. Music and food round out this festive and fun night.
Kiteboarding, Windsurfing and Parasailing
Every winter, the El Norte winds blow down the Sea of Cortez, and the East Cape becomes a kiteboarding and windsurfing paradise. In January, and you can watch (or join) the world’s best in the annual Lord of the Wind competition. Parasailing is also popular in the Cabo Bay, and you can soar above the Arch alone or with a friend!
Scuba Diving
Although great diving can happen in many places in Los Cabos, Cabo Pulmo is a spot along the East Cape that makes a superb day trip. It is actually the oldest and largest living coral reef in North America, and the waters boast the highest concentration of fish anywhere in the entire Sea of Cortez.
For those with less time, snorkelling is available on pretty much any area beach and will usually yield hundreds of colourful fish species.
